Baby Eczema - 3 Common Reasons Babies Suffer from Eczema

In this article we will discuss baby eczema and 3 reasons your baby may be suffering from this common health issue. It might be a common issue, but nevertheless it is very difficult to watch your child suffer from eczema. The three reasons outlined below can help identify what might be causing your child's eczema symptoms.

1. Food allergies: Usually when you hear of food allergies, people think of an immediate response. Very rarely do people associate a subtle delayed symptom to a problem with a food. However a headache, sinus congestion, even eczema can be delayed responses of a food allergy.

Although wheat and dairy are common foods that cause delayed allergies, there are many others that can as well. Soy, tomatoes, even sugar can lead to problems like a headache or sinus congestion. Baby eczema could very well be caused by a problem with a food in your baby's diet.

2. Pet Allergies: Allergy symptoms can show up in many different ways. Common symptoms are sneezing, itchy eyes and nasal congestion, but they can present themselves in other forms as well, including eczema. Going through allergy testing is the best way to find out if your baby is allergic to an animal.

3.Environmental Irritants: Detergents, cigarette smoke, household dust and other irritants can also cause baby eczema. You can keep a log of what baby is exposed to and discover if any of these items are a problem, or you can choose to do allergy testing to find out what might be the reason.

There are hypo-allergenic detergents and mild cleansers on the market that can help reduce eczema symptoms as well if your baby has sensitive skin.

In this article we discussed baby eczema and 3 reasons your baby may be suffering from this common skin condition. Food and pet allergies as well as problems with environmental irritants can all cause the dry, itchy skin. Eliminate the factors that are a problem for your baby and you'll most likely see the eczema disappear.
